Transaction 51f73b648f9f9b81be8941cc95494097aa47ce958630c33250f29875cf67dd3a
2 Input
2 Outputs
- 51f73b648f9f9b81be8941cc95494097aa47ce958630c33250f29875cf67dd3a:0
- 51f73b648f9f9b81be8941cc95494097aa47ce958630c33250f29875cf67dd3a:1
value 5766660
address 1FuPCVMuAjtRfREo9VDWZpXzLr8QmFWjND
value 20000000
address 13VUeJiBVnn4od83yTGt3SrXv3sYR4AthU